How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Grants Pass?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Grants Pass Studio Apartments | $925 | $925 | $925 |
| Grants Pass 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,198 | $1,000 | $1,400 |
| Grants Pass 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,389 | $1,250 | $1,650 |
| Grants Pass 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,950 | $1,950 | $1,950 |
